VSL updates Vienna Instruments and announces MIRx Offer

10th April 2014

The Vienna Symphonic Library team has updated their free Vienna Instruments player with the ability to integrate the optional MIRx Reverb Mixing Extensions. Direct Access to Renowned Concert Halls and Sound Stages
Based on Vienna's MIR (Multi Impulse Response) convolution technology, the MIRx Reverb Mixing Extensions were launched in August 2013, providing an easy and affordable way to integrate the acoustics of two halls of the Vienna Konzerthaus as well as the famed Teldex Scoring Stage in Berlin directly into the Vienna Instruments Pro player. MIRx offers the same sonic quality of the company's mixing solution Vienna MIR Pro and its RoomPacks.

With hundreds of included presets for specific instrumentation and stage settings, it promises a perfectly balanced orchestral sound with just a few mouse clicks. Now, the company's free Vienna Instruments sample engine has been updated to support the MIRx Extensions as well. The updated software is available for download at the Vienna Symphonic Library website.
